Shares in defence technology firm Qinetiq have tumbled by 15% after delayed orders led to a second profit warning in as many months.

In November, the firm warned results may not meet City hopes because of "short-term" authorities over defence contracts.

Now it said it had seen no improvement in the conditions.

Shares plunged as much as 15% at one stage as the firm warned results for its traditionally stronger second half would now be on a par with the first six months of the year due to the delays.

Qinetiq said the US decision "has not yet clarified the position" for orders of its armour plating and sniper-detection equipment, as well as Talon robots used for purposes such as bomb disposal. The firm has supplied around 3,000 of the robots to Iraq and Afghanistan so far.

In its UK-focused Europe, Middle East and Africa (EMEA) division, the group said "political and economic" factors continued to delay spending at the end of the financial year.

Uncertainty ahead of a potential change of Government in the looming general election - as well as the UK's dire public finances - have constrained spending decisions with possible budget cuts on the way.

New chief executive Leo Quinn, who joined late last year, has launched a review of the business that will report in May.
